India, July 18 -- As the war in Gaza rages on, US President Donald Trump is reportedly unhappy with his close ally -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u. As per White House and US state department officials, Trump's sentiments towards the Israeli leader comes after a church site was struck in Gaza, killing at least three people.

On Thursday, as Israel continues its bombardment in Gaza, Israeli strikes hit the Holy Family Church in Gaza City, which is also the only Catholic Church in the Palestinian territory.

The shelling from the Israeli strike injured around 10 people and also damaged the church compound, where hundreds of Palestinians have been taking shelter amid the ongoing war.
